Specification
Name: Retro Bronze Style Duckbilled Shaped Hasp Lock
Color: Bronze
Material: Iron with antique brass plated, anti-rust and durable
Size: approx.59 x 40 mm / 2.32 x 1.57 inch

I wanted to replace a defective latch near the carrying handle of a guitar case. This retro style box toggle latch worked out great. The hard part was removal of the original latch. A small rotary tool is essential for this procedure. With the old latch removed , I pop riveted this new latch in place and was able to install a TSA approved padlock on the latch for some additional security. I like the way this latch works and seems sturdy enough for long time use. I would buy again should the need arises.

I picked up a pair of these to try out on the first of 3 matching boxes.They're good enough that I will go ahead and pick up 2 more pairs to finish the others. The screws they come with are the perfect length for fastening to 1/2" thick material, and would easily work on 3/4" material. I was able to use the fasteners that come with these latches, which is not always the case. They are easy to strip as I did on a few of them.They look nice enough and match the other "aged bronze" finish on my handle and hinges pretty well.HOWEVER: They are cheaply made stamped material and the edges are a little sharp. This includes the bottom of the latch part where your fingers will lift from. I took a gentle file to the edges of mine to round the edges just a bit. I would NOT recommend these latches for something that is expected to get heavy use. For my next project I will try something else.
